Rebels Kill 2 Children, 1 Soldier at Church
Burundian rebels killed two children and a soldier in an attack on a church in the Central African country, government officials said.
Ethnic Hutu rebels struck early Tuesday morning, tossing grenades and firing at people seeking shelter in a church in Mkondo, near the Tanzanian border in southern Burundi, officials said.
“The rebels looted medicine and clothes belonging to the people, who were taking refuge in the church during the night because it is close to a military position,” local administrator Emmanuel Ndinga said.
He said the attack killed an 11-year-old, a 16-year-old and a soldier and also injured six civilians.
Officials said the raid was carried out by rebel soldiers who crossed from refugee camps in Tanzania.
